  /*
   * SBC8641D board specific routines
   *
   * Copyright 2008 Wind River Systems Inc.
   *
   * By Paul Gortmaker (see MAINTAINERS for contact information)
   *
   * Based largely on the 8641 HPCN support by Freescale Semiconductor Inc.
   *
   * This program is free software; you can redistribute  it and/or modify it
   * under  the terms of  the GNU General  Public License as published by the
   * Free Software Foundation;  either version 2 of the  License, or (at your
   * option) any later version.
   */
  
  #include <linux/stddef.h>
  #include <linux/kernel.h>
  #include <linux/pci.h>
  #include <linux/kdev_t.h>
  #include <linux/delay.h>
  #include <linux/seq_file.h>
  #include <linux/of_platform.h>
  
  #include <asm/time.h>
  #include <asm/machdep.h>
  #include <asm/pci-bridge.h>
  #include <asm/prom.h>
  #include <mm/mmu_decl.h>
  #include <asm/udbg.h>
  
  #include <asm/mpic.h>
  
  #include <sysdev/fsl_pci.h>
  #include <sysdev/fsl_soc.h>
  
  #include "mpc86xx.h"
  
  static void __init
  sbc8641_setup_arch(void)
  {
  	if (ppc_md.progress)
  		ppc_md.progress("sbc8641_setup_arch()", 0);
  
  	printk("SBC8641 board from Wind River
  ");
  
  #ifdef CONFIG_SMP
  	mpc86xx_smp_init();
  #endif
  
  	fsl_pci_assign_primary();
  }
  
  
  static void
  sbc8641_show_cpuinfo(struct seq_file *m)
  {
  	uint svid = mfspr(SPRN_SVR);
  
  	seq_printf(m, "Vendor\t\t: Wind River Systems
  ");
  
  	seq_printf(m, "SVR\t\t: 0x%x
  ", svid);
  }
  
  
  /*
   * Called very early, device-tree isn't unflattened
   */
  static int __init sbc8641_probe(void)
  {
  	unsigned long root = of_get_flat_dt_root();
  
  	if (of_flat_dt_is_compatible(root, "wind,sbc8641"))
  		return 1;	/* Looks good */
  
  	return 0;
  }
  
  static long __init
  mpc86xx_time_init(void)
  {
  	unsigned int temp;
  
  	/* Set the time base to zero */
  	mtspr(SPRN_TBWL, 0);
  	mtspr(SPRN_TBWU, 0);
  
  	temp = mfspr(SPRN_HID0);
  	temp |= HID0_TBEN;
  	mtspr(SPRN_HID0, temp);
  	asm volatile("isync");
  
  	return 0;
  }
  
  static const struct of_device_id of_bus_ids[] __initconst = {
  	{ .compatible = "simple-bus", },
  	{ .compatible = "gianfar", },
  	{ .compatible = "fsl,mpc8641-pcie", },
  	{},
  };
  
  static int __init declare_of_platform_devices(void)
  {
  	of_platform_bus_probe(NULL, of_bus_ids, NULL);
  
  	return 0;
  }
  machine_arch_initcall(sbc8641, declare_of_platform_devices);
  
  define_machine(sbc8641) {
  	.name			= "SBC8641D",
  	.probe			= sbc8641_probe,
  	.setup_arch		= sbc8641_setup_arch,
  	.init_IRQ		= mpc86xx_init_irq,
  	.show_cpuinfo		= sbc8641_show_cpuinfo,
  	.get_irq		= mpic_get_irq,
  	.restart		= fsl_rstcr_restart,
  	.time_init		= mpc86xx_time_init,
  	.calibrate_decr		= generic_calibrate_decr,
  	.progress		= udbg_progress,
  #ifdef CONFIG_PCI
  	.pcibios_fixup_bus	= fsl_pcibios_fixup_bus,
  #endif
  };
